Aslan Brewing Company: NOW ON TAP: 館山市 (Tateyama)

館山市 (Tateyama) Japanese Lager // 5.2% ABV // 18 IBU // 11.6 P light body + refreshing + crisp This premium quality pale lager is made with whole white rice and German Pilsener malt, which went through a 4-hour cereal/decoction mash. Idle Hands Craft Ales: Brewer’s Spotlight: Kill Your Idles Pluot

This week’s spotlight shines on Kill Your Idles: Pluot. Part of our line of Kettle Sour Ales, these beers draw inspiration from Berliner Weiss from Northern Germany.
